What companies run services between Lille, France and Rheine, Germany?

You can take a train from Lille Europe to Rheine via Amsterdam Centraal in around 6h 13m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Lille - Europe Train Station to Rheine, Bahnhof via Brussels South, Münster bus stop, and Münster Hauptbahnhof in around 7h 10m.
